| strong-arm |
| strong-arm | (v) handle roughly, Example: He was strong-armed by the policemen |
| strong-arm | (v) be bossy towards, Syn. boss around, bullyrag, browbeat, push around, hector, bully, ballyrag, Example: Her big brother always bullied her when she was young |
| strong-arm | (v) use physical force against, Example: They strong-armed me when I left the restaurant |
